Climbing in Cheddar, Somerset, UK, England

Channel:
Subscribers:
3,260
Published on ● Video Link: https://www.youtube.com/watch?v=yP69xYx0Ncw



Duration: 1:42
527 views
6


Climbing and goats







Tags:
Cheddar
Climbing
Goats
Somerset
UK
England
Holiday
Tourism
Travel
Cheese
Rock
Bikes
Cycling